Entering the Market: Tips for First-Time Home Buyers
Navigating your real estate market can feel daunting for first-time home buyers. However, with the suitable guidance and preparation, you can successfully navigate this exciting process.
Here are some essential tips to keep in mind:
- Investigate the market thoroughly. Understand ongoing trends, typical home prices in your preferred area, and elements that can influence property values.
- Get pre-approved for a mortgage. This will give you a clear understanding of your buying power and make the home buying experience smoother.
- Identify a reputable real estate agent. A good agent may provide valuable knowledge about the market, help you discover suitable properties, and negotiate on your behalf.
- Refrain from rushing into a decision. Take your time to inspect multiple properties, ask questions, and meticulously consider all your options.
Remember, buying a home is a major financial decision. By following these tips, you can successfully navigate the market and find the perfect place to call home.
